Open Day attracts huge interest

Staff and volunteers were kept busy at our annual Open Day with more than a thousand visitors and prospective students coming through the doors at our Mt Albert and Waitākere campuses.

Te Puna was a hub of activity at Mt Albert with all our pathways offering hands-on programme displays, activities, exhibitions, tours and trial lectures.

The enthusiasm of staff and their passion for learning was palpable as they demonstrated their offerings: Creative Industries hosted mask workshops; Environmental and Animal Sciences staged “A guess what this is” with a trichobezoar; while CIE encouraged Mataaho visitors to try their hand at virtual welding and automotive electronics.

 

Visitors to Waitākere were given a first-hand view of our medical imaging, nursing and community development programmes.
